Associate a set of properties to a MAP name or MAP ID.

Please see attached PDF for an example of what I am referring to.

When using Map Tooltips, when you hover over a node, you always get the same information regardless of the context of the map that the tooltips are being used for.  This really limits the possibilities of using Map Tooltips in a large Solarwinds environment.

An example.  You hover over a router node on your circuits page and you'll see circuit information such as Circuit ID, Local LATA, Dial-in Modem #, SmartNet Account number, etc.  The node is part of a circuit map so hovering over a router gives you pertinent information about the circuit.

Now when you move over to a map that shows servers in racks, when you hover over the Exchange Server node, ideally you would want to see information such as Serial Number, License Key, make and model of server, RAM etc.  But what shows up is circuit stuff.  (please see attached PDF as an example).

What would be awesome is if we could associate specific property variables (either custom properties or NCM properties) TO THE MAP ID or MAP NAME.  Then when you hover over a node on MAP "A", you will see A,B,C properties that you want to see.. and when you hover over a node on MAP "B", you will see X,Y,Z properties.

This would really help those in our support center.  Those dealing with circuits, WAN, LAN stuff see information that is relevent to them.   Those dealing with servers, IP cameras, and peripherals such as printers and appliances would see information specific to the map they are on.
